Hands ON Food Drive
Hands On, a volunteer group that helps the Second Harvest Food Bank has a specific mission to help students stay healthy. This group packs bags with healthy snacks that kids would like, and then sends them to 3rd graders. The reason Hands On targets third graders is that third graders have been found to not get enough protein in their meals. Hands On asked our team if we would be interested in helping with a food drive at our high school, Warren G. Harding High School. The food drive was on Monday from 8:30 to 2:30.
